A few days ago, at 3:30am on Friday (February 2), 30-year-old Melaka-based businessman and social media influencer, Boss Mario, was discovered to have gone missing as he didn’t return home.

His staff took to his official Facebook page to announce his disappearance and asked the general public to look out for him.

Thankfully, yesterday (February 4), they shared that Boss Mario was discovered at a hospital after he checked himself in to be admitted after going missing in action for about 72 hours.

“Alhamdulillah, Boss Mario has been found safe and sound, thank you to everyone who helped and cooperated in this case. Boss Mario is currently being treated and needs to rest as his body is weak. We hope that everyone who sees this can pray for Boss Mario’s health to be restored and to be able to be with his staff again,” they wrote.

 

While everyone is glad to see the influencer’s safe return, one question remained. Where did he disappear to?

It turns out that Boss Mario went to hide out in an abandoned property as he felt stressed about paying his 22 staff members of his 2 mobile phone stores their bonuses.

According to a report by Guang Ming Daily, the pressure of not being able to provide his team with their bonuses led Boss Mario to flee to the abandoned, empty house in Klebang, Melaka, to find peace and quiet.

Thankfully, he did not sustain any serious injuries and is back in the arms of his family members.
